Transaction 51509dac64e812e589c23e44976132386062a7511a21ba1247525194f3f15815

1 Input
2 Outputs
  • 51509dac64e812e589c23e44976132386062a7511a21ba1247525194f3f15815:0
  • value  1153355
    address  1DPtgDcAjDu4ateHmmEXnJLRUiR4KpPvos
  • 51509dac64e812e589c23e44976132386062a7511a21ba1247525194f3f15815:1
  • value  209107045
    address  3Hq1t6qZaPVCEvHVoH75A1xy6BR7mVZ3AE